Abstract

The hydrodechlorination (HDC) of chlorophenols on 5 wt.% Pd/C catalyst was investigated at low temperature under ordinary pressure by using triethylamine (Et3N) as a base additive. The inhibition effect of Et3N on the HDC existed obviously and can be efficiently reduced by stepwise addition of Et3N. For the first time, the high activity of Pd/C for HDC of chlorophenols was observed at 258 K.
